Key Features

  • 48 x 10/100/1000 PoE+ access ports
  • 2 x 1G RJ45 uplink ports
  • 4 x 10G SFP uplink slots
  • Managed access switch architecture
  • PoE+ support for powered endpoints
  • Gigabit Ethernet access layer design
  • High-density edge switching for campus and branch networks

Keep access-layer services online with a switch built for high-density PoE deployments. The ICX 7150-48PF-4X10GR-A combines 48 10/100/1000 PoE+ ports with 2 x 1G RJ45 uplinks and 4 x 10G SFP slots, giving network teams a practical mix of edge connectivity and higher-speed aggregation options. This configuration is well suited to environments where power and port count matter as much as uplink design. PoE+ support simplifies deployment of IP phones, wireless access points, and surveillance devices by delivering data and power over a single cable. The 10G SFP slots provide a cleaner path for upstream bandwidth when access traffic grows, while the 1G RJ45 uplinks can support straightforward integration into existing copper-based infrastructure. For organizations standardizing on a durable access switch platform, this model offers the density and uplink mix that help avoid bottlenecks at the edge. It is a strong fit for campus closets, branch offices, and distributed sites that need dependable switching without overbuying capacity they will not use on day one.
